Tools You Need for Elaborate Drawing

Now that you’re ready to dive into the world of elaborate drawing, let’s talk about the tools you’ll need. Don’t worry, you don’t have to break the bank to get started. Here’s a list of essentials:

  • Pencils (ranging from 2H to 6B)
  • High-quality sketchbook or drawing paper
  • Eraser (both kneaded and regular)
  • Fine-tip pens for outlining
  • Blending stumps for shading
  • Reference photos or objects

And if you’re feeling fancy, you can also invest in digital drawing tablets or colored pencils to take your artwork to the next level.

Techniques to Master Elaborate Drawing

So, you’ve got your tools ready. Now it’s time to learn some techniques that will take your elaborate drawing skills to the next level. Here are a few to get you started:

  • Hatching and Cross-Hatching: This is all about creating texture and depth by using parallel lines. It’s a classic technique that never goes out of style.
  • Stippling: Think of it as creating art with tiny dots. It’s time-consuming, but the results are absolutely stunning.
  • Blending: Use blending stumps or your fingers to create smooth transitions between shades. It’s perfect for creating realistic skin tones or soft gradients.

And don’t forget about experimenting with different textures and patterns. The more you practice, the more confident you’ll become in adding those intricate details.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in Elaborate Drawing

Let’s face it, we’ve all been there. You start working on a masterpiece, and then BAM! You make a mistake that ruins the entire piece. But don’t worry, it happens to the best of us. Here are a few common mistakes to watch out for:

  • Overworking your drawing: Sometimes less is more. Don’t feel the need to add every single detail. Leave some space for the viewer’s imagination.
  • Ignoring proportions: Make sure everything is in proportion. Nothing ruins a piece faster than a wonky face or a misshapen object.
  • Not using reference photos: Even the best artists use references. It’s not cheating; it’s smart.

Remember, practice makes perfect. So, don’t get discouraged if you make a mistake. Learn from it and move on.

Inspiration from Famous Artists

Let’s take a moment to appreciate some of the greatest artists who have mastered the art of elaborate drawing. From Leonardo da Vinci to Albrecht Dürer, these artists have left a lasting impact on the world of art. Here’s a quick look at their contributions:

  • Leonardo da Vinci: Known for his detailed anatomical drawings, da Vinci’s work continues to inspire artists to this day.
  • Albrecht Dürer: A master of intricate patterns and textures, Dürer’s engravings are a testament to the power of elaborate drawing.

So, if you ever feel stuck, take a look at their work. You might just find the inspiration you need to keep going.
